from unittest import TestCase import pandas as pd from .test_trading_calendar import ExchangeCalendarTestBase from catalyst.utils.calendars.exchange_calendar_ice import ICEExchangeCalendar class ICECalendarTestCase(ExchangeCalendarTestBase, TestCase): answer_key_filename = 'ice' calendar_class = ICEExchangeCalendar MAX_SESSION_HOURS = 22 def test_hurricane_sandy_one_day(self): self.assertFalse( self.calendar.is_session(pd.Timestamp("2012-10-29", tz='UTC')) ) # ICE wasn't closed on day 2 of hurricane sandy self.assertTrue( self.calendar.is_session(pd.Timestamp("2012-10-30", tz='UTC')) ) def test_2016_holidays(self): # 2016 holidays: # new years: 2016-01-01 # good friday: 2016-03-25 # christmas (observed): 2016-12-26 for date in ["2016-01-01", "2016-03-25", "2016-12-26"]: self.assertFalse( self.calendar.is_session(pd.Timestamp(date, tz='UTC')) ) def test_2016_early_closes(self): # 2016 early closes # mlk: 2016-01-18 # presidents: 2016-02-15 # mem day: 2016-05-30 # independence day: 2016-07-04 # labor: 2016-09-05 # thanksgiving: 2016-11-24 for date in ["2016-01-18", "2016-02-15", "2016-05-30", "2016-07-04", "2016-09-05", "2016-11-24"]: dt = pd.Timestamp(date, tz='UTC') self.assertTrue(dt in self.calendar.early_closes) market_close = self.calendar.schedule.loc[dt].market_close self.assertEqual( 13, # all ICE early closes are 1 pm local market_close.tz_convert(self.calendar.tz).hour, )
